本文目录导读:
随着互联网技术的飞速发展,网站已经成为了企业展示形象、宣传产品和提供服务的窗口,为了适应不同设备和屏幕尺寸的用户需求,响应式网站模板应运而生,本文将详细介绍响应式网站模板的设计与实现,帮助您打造符合未来趋势的网站。
响应式网站模板概述
响应式网站模板是一种能够根据用户设备屏幕尺寸自动调整布局、图片大小、字体等元素,以提供最佳浏览体验的网站设计,它主要基于HTML5、CSS3和JavaScript等技术,通过媒体查询(Media Queries)实现布局的适应性。
图片来源于网络,如有侵权联系删除
响应式网站模板设计原则
1、简洁明了:响应式网站模板应注重内容简洁,避免过多的装饰元素,确保用户能够快速找到所需信息。
2、适应性:网站模板应适应不同设备屏幕尺寸,如手机、平板电脑和电脑等。
3、用户体验:注重用户体验,优化网站加载速度,提高页面交互性。
4、易于维护:模板结构清晰,便于后期维护和更新。
5、SEO优化:遵循搜索引擎优化(SEO)原则,提高网站在搜索引擎中的排名。
图片来源于网络,如有侵权联系删除
响应式网站模板实现方法
1、HTML5:使用HTML5标签,如<header>、<nav>、<section>、<article>、<footer>
等,构建网站结构。
2、CSS3:利用CSS3的媒体查询功能,实现不同屏幕尺寸下的布局调整,以下是一个简单的示例:
/* 默认样式 */ body { margin: 0; padding: 0; font-family: Arial, sans-serif; } /* 手机端样式 */ @media screen and (max-width: 600px) { .container { padding: 10px; } } /* 平板电脑端样式 */ @media screen and (min-width: 601px) and (max-width: 1024px) { .container { padding: 20px; } } /* 电脑端样式 */ @media screen and (min-width: 1025px) { .container { padding: 30px; } }
3、JavaScript:利用JavaScript实现动态效果,如图片懒加载、轮播图等。
4、响应式图片:使用<img>
标签的srcset
属性,为不同屏幕尺寸提供不同分辨率的图片。
5、响应式字体:使用CSS3的font-size
属性和font-family
属性,实现不同屏幕尺寸下的字体适应性。
图片来源于网络,如有侵权联系删除
响应式网站模板案例分析
以下是一个简单的响应式网站模板示例:
<!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>响应式网站模板示例</title> <link rel="stylesheet" href="style.css"> </head> <body> <header> <h1>响应式网站模板示例</h1> <nav> <ul> <li><a href="#">首页</a></li> <li><a href="#">关于我们</a></li> <li><a href="#">产品中心</a></li> <li><a href="#">新闻动态</a></li> <li><a href="#">联系我们</a></li> </ul> </nav> </header> <section> <article> <h2>文章标题</h2> <p>这里是文章内容...</p> </article> </section> <footer> <p>版权所有 © 2021 响应式网站模板示例</p> </footer> </body> </html>
在style.css
文件中,您可以添加响应式样式,如上述CSS3示例。
响应式网站模板是未来网站设计的发展趋势,它能够为用户提供更好的浏览体验,通过本文的介绍,相信您已经掌握了响应式网站模板的设计与实现方法,在实际开发过程中,请根据自身需求不断优化和调整,打造出符合未来趋势的网站。
标签: #响应式网站模板
评论列表